In a Scanning Electron Microscope
A Sculpture Seen By Microscope
A microscopic elephant sculpture walks across a surface smaller than a coin. The work considers a colossal presence in a fragile state.
"Fragile Giant" holds a Guinness World Record as the smallest animal sculpture, standing only 0.157mm tall. This minute representation of an elephant speaks volumes beyond its scale, directing our gaze towards the dire situation of real-world elephants. A century ago, 12 million elephants roamed in Africa, a number which has precipitously dropped to around 400,000 today, largely due to poaching and habitat loss. How's It Made?
How the world's smallest figurative sculptures are built — atom by atom — using quantum physics.
The nano sculptures are created using a process called multiphoton lithography — a form of fabrication born directly from the strange rules of quantum physics. Instead of carving material away, focused pulses of laser light trigger chemical reactions only at the exact point where multiple photons interact simultaneously, allowing structures to be built with extraordinary precision in three dimensions.
At this scale, the boundary between science and imagination begins to disappear. The sculptures are not shaped by human hands in the traditional sense, but emerge from controlled interactions between light, matter, and probability itself. Using techniques developed from cutting-edge physics and nanotechnology, it becomes possible to create objects smaller than the wavelength of visible light — structures that exist at the threshold of what humans can physically perceive.

Filmed inside a Scanning Electron Microscope
Ground-breaking film created in a Scanning Electron Microscope — in collaboration with Stefan Diller, Würzburg, Germany.
This revolutionary filming technique draws on the early days of the film industry, using stop-frame photography to painstakingly create a moving image.
Using a Scanning Electron Microscope (SEM) at high magnification, hundreds of images of the nano sculpture were captured as a Piezo stage was rotated to a precision of below one ten-thousandth of a degree. Each individual frame can take several minutes to capture — meaning a single second of film can take up to four hours to shoot. A painstakingly detailed process, in which any micro-blip means starting again from scratch.
All of this is achieved with a ground-breaking optical system developed by Stefan Diller in Würzburg, Germany, called Nanoflight.Creator — the only system in the world capable of SEM film.

Endangered elephants
African elephant populations have fallen from an estimated 12 million a century ago to some 400,000 today. Ivory-seeking poachers killed 100,000 African elephants in just three years. Fragile Giant is a quiet protest at the smallest possible scale.
